
Orangewomen Picked 10th in Preseason BIG EAST Poll
10/26/2001 3:19:52 PM | Women's Basketball
NEWARK, N.J. - The Orangewomen basketball team was picked 10th in the 2001-02 BIG EAST Coaches' Preseason Poll released on Thursday.
Connecticut was the coaches' choice to win the BIG EAST regular-season title. Defending national champion Notre Dame was picked to finish second, and Rutgers was the coaches' pick for third place.
Syracuse returns six letterwinners from last season's team that went 12-15 overall and 6-10 in the league. The Orangewomen finished tied for eighth in the BIG EAST and lost their first-round game of the conference tournament to Georgetown.
The league also announced its preseason awards. Connecticut's Sue Bird was named Preseason Player of the Year and Notre Dame's Jacqueline Batteast was tabbed the Preseason Rookie of the Year.
2001-02 BIG EAST Coaches' Preseason Poll
| 1. | Connecticut (11) | 167 |
| 2. | Notre Dame (2) | 155 |
| 3. | Rutgers | 143 |
| 4. | Boston College | 125 |
| 5. | Villanova (1) | 112 |
| 6. | Virginia Tech | 111 |
| 7. | Georgetown | 102 |
| 8. | Miami | 86 |
| 9. | Seton Hall | 75 |
| 10. | Syracuse | 59 |
| 11. | Providence | 56 |
| 12. | Pittsburgh | 41 |
| 13. | St. John's | 23 |
| 14. | West Virginia | 19 |
First-place votes in parentheses
Coaches could not vote for their own teams
